Weak Airflow Coming From The Vents

One of the earliest signs of trouble is reduced airflow. You may notice that rooms take longer to cool or that air coming from the vents feels weaker than it used to.

When airflow drops, the system often has to run longer to maintain comfortable temperatures. Over time, this extra strain can affect overall performance and create uneven cooling throughout the home.

Uneven Temperatures Between Rooms

Have you ever noticed one room feels comfortable while another remains noticeably warmer? Uneven cooling is often an indication that something within the system is preventing balanced air distribution.

Unusual Sounds During Operation

Air conditioners are designed to operate relatively quietly. If you begin hearing buzzing, rattling, clicking, or grinding noises, the system may be trying to tell you that something is not functioning properly.

Longer Cooling Cycles Than Normal

If your system seems to run continuously during moderate weather, it may be working harder than necessary. Longer cooling cycles often indicate declining efficiency or performance issues that deserve attention.

The longer these conditions continue, the more strain the system experiences while trying to maintain indoor comfort.

Rising Indoor Humidity Levels

Your air conditioner helps remove excess moisture from indoor air while cooling your home. If rooms suddenly feel sticky or uncomfortable, even when temperatures appear normal, the system may not be managing humidity effectively.

Changes in indoor humidity are often among the first comfort-related warning signs homeowners notice.

Frequent System Cycling

An air conditioner that turns on and off repeatedly throughout the day may be experiencing short cycling. This pattern can reduce comfort consistency while placing additional stress on system components.

Addressing the issue early helps restore smoother operation and supports more stable indoor temperatures.

Declining Comfort Usually Starts Small

Many significant cooling problems begin with small changes that are easy to dismiss. A little less airflow, a little more noise, or slightly longer run times may not seem serious at first. Yet these are often the clues that allow homeowners to act before larger issues develop.
